Imported Upstream version 1.63.0
[platform/upstream/boost.git] / libs / geometry / doc / doxy / doxygen_output / xml / structboost_1_1geometry_1_1traits_1_1interior__rings.xml
1 <?xml version='1.0' encoding='UTF-8' standalone='no'?>
2 <doxygen x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:noNamespaceSchemaLocation="compound.xsd" version="1.8.6">
3   <compounddef id="structboost_1_1geometry_1_1traits_1_1interior__rings" kind="struct" prot="public">
4     <compoundname>boost::geometry::traits::interior_rings</compoundname>
5     <includes local="no">interior_rings.hpp</includes>
6     <templateparamlist>
7       <param>
8         <type>typename Geometry</type>
9       </param>
10     </templateparamlist>
11       <sectiondef kind="public-func">
12       <memberdef kind="function" id="structboost_1_1geometry_1_1traits_1_1interior__rings_1a0debcf828e6b6f38aa0aa28eb3eb7266" prot="public" static="no" const="no" explicit="no" inline="no" virt="non-virtual">
13         <type></type>
14         <definition>boost::geometry::traits::interior_rings&lt; Geometry &gt;::BOOST_MPL_ASSERT_MSG</definition>
15         <argsstring>(false, NOT_IMPLEMENTED_FOR_THIS_GEOMETRY_TYPE,(types&lt; Geometry &gt;))</argsstring>
16         <name>BOOST_MPL_ASSERT_MSG</name>
17         <param>
18           <type>false</type>
19         </param>
20         <param>
21           <type>NOT_IMPLEMENTED_FOR_THIS_GEOMETRY_TYPE</type>
22         </param>
23         <param>
24           <type>(types&lt; Geometry &gt;)</type>
25         </param>
26         <briefdescription>
27         </briefdescription>
28         <detaileddescription>
29         </detaileddescription>
30         <inbodydescription>
31         </inbodydescription>
32         <location file="/home/ubuntu/boost/boost/geometry/core/interior_rings.hpp" line="48" column="1"/>
33       </memberdef>
34       </sectiondef>
35     <briefdescription>
36 <para>Traits class defining access to <ref refid="structboost_1_1geometry_1_1traits_1_1interior__rings" kindref="compound">interior_rings</ref> of a polygon. </para>    </briefdescription>
37     <detaileddescription>
38 <para>defines access (const and non const) to interior ring</para><para><simplesect kind="par"><title>Geometries:</title><para><itemizedlist>
39 <listitem><para>polygon </para></listitem></itemizedlist>
40 </para></simplesect>
41 <simplesect kind="par"><title>Specializations should provide:</title><para><itemizedlist>
42 <listitem><para>static inline INTERIOR&amp; get(POLY&amp;)</para></listitem><listitem><para>static inline const INTERIOR&amp; get(POLY const&amp;) </para></listitem></itemizedlist>
43 </para></simplesect>
44 <parameterlist kind="templateparam"><parameteritem>
45 <parameternamelist>
46 <parametername>Geometry</parametername>
47 </parameternamelist>
48 <parameterdescription>
49 <para>geometry </para></parameterdescription>
50 </parameteritem>
51 </parameterlist>
52 </para>    </detaileddescription>
53     <location file="/home/ubuntu/boost/boost/geometry/core/interior_rings.hpp" line="47" column="1" bodyfile="/home/ubuntu/boost/boost/geometry/core/interior_rings.hpp" bodystart="46" bodyend="53"/>
54     <listofallmembers>
55       <member refid="structboost_1_1geometry_1_1traits_1_1interior__rings_1a0debcf828e6b6f38aa0aa28eb3eb7266" prot="public" virt="non-virtual"><scope>boost::geometry::traits::interior_rings</scope><name>BOOST_MPL_ASSERT_MSG</name></member>
56     </listofallmembers>
57   </compounddef>
58 </doxygen>